PBA: TNT gets sweet revenge, blasts Titan Ultra by 34

TNT returned the favor by crushing Titan Ultra, 114-80, to go above .500 again in the PBA Season 50 Governors’ Cup in Montalban, Saturday.

Still remembering the 103-87 defeat they suffered to the same team back in the first round last July 22, the defending champions rolled to a 34-21 lead after the first 12 minutes, and that was all they needed to set the tone for the rout.

They did face some resistance in the fourth when the 26-point spread got cut to 14, but the Giant Risers fell flat again, and the Tropang 5G cruised to the 34-point win to bounce back from their 88-83 loss to NLEX just last Tuesday.

They improved to 4-3 in the process, maintaining their third-place standing in Group A behind the Road Warriors (6-1) and San Miguel (5-2).

“We made a concerted effort to focus on defense. Even when we lost to NLEX, I thought we played great, great defense; we just couldn’t put enough points on the board because we didn’t have Jordan and Roger,” Coach Chot Reyes said.

“Thankfully, tonight, we had both of them in … it was a big thing that we have an almost complete complement at our disposal today,” he added.

Jordan Heading led TNT with 23 points and five assists off the bench. Rahlir Hollis-Jefferson tallied another double-double of 19 points and 12 rebounds.

Brandon Ganuelas-Rosser came through with 19 points, nine of which he made in the opening period alone to spearhead the early breakaway. The athletic big man also finished with four rebounds and the same number of assists.

Rey Nambatac delivered 14 points, five rebounds, and eight assists, while Kim Aurin added 12 markers for the Tropa, who will look to get revenge against NLEX next Tuesday, August 11, at the Ninoy Aquino Stadium.

Tirell Brown, on the other hand, led Titan Ultra with 14 points and 11 rebounds in the loss, which dropped the team dead last in the group with a 2-6 record.

Rookie Bryan Sajonia and Jerrick Balanza made 13 points apiece while Ato Ular added 10 markers for the Giant Risers, who got sent crashing back to earth after their 132-128 win against guest team Macau the last time out.

Titan Ultra will next face the Beermen on Wednesday, August 12, in Antipolo, taking on the very same team that gave them a 143-105 beating last July 29.

The Scores:

TNT 114 – Heading 23, Ganuelas-Rosser 19, Hollis-Jefferson 19, Nambatac 14, Aurin 12, Ferrer 9, Galkinato 4, Pogoy 4, Jalalon 2, Erram 2, Quitevis 2, Khobuntin 2.

Titan Ultra 80 – Brown 14, Balanza 13, Sajonia 13, Ular 10, Sumang 8, Munzon 7, Caralipio 6, Wong 4, Yu 3, Dionisio 2, Cuntapay 0, Javillonar 0, Amores 0, Pessumal 0.

Quarterscores: 34-21, 60-44, 82-60, 114-80.
